DORA’S REVIVAL Festival

Build on the slopes of mountain Kordyla, Dora is one of the most picturesque wine village of Lemesos district. From the village you can enjoy striking panoramic views of the surrounding vineyards.

Take a leisurely stroll through village’s narrow cobbled to appreciate the traditional architecture; masterfully stone-build houses, with curved wooden front doors, hanging balconies, paved courtyards filled with flowers and herbs. When you arrive at the village’s cobbled square make a stop and enjoy a Cyprus coffee and traditional local delicacies under the tall sycamore trees. You can then walk uphill towards the church of Fotolambousa, which is near the starting point of the village’s Nature Trail. Here is the best viewpoint of the surrounding area.

The village’s Festival offers an opportunity to participate at tradition related workshops and taste local delicacies. Choose between a guided walk of the Kordylas Nature Trail (at 10:00), Experiential Textile Workshops, Jewellery Making and painting, a market with traditional products (between 11:00 – 18:00), Grape harvest Revival, Zivania Distillation, and making of Palouzes (at 11:00), demonstration of shearing and milking of sheep along with halloumi making (at 13:30), kneading and baking bread in a traditional wood oven (at 16:00), a Guided Tour/ Walk of the village (at 17:30). The locals will be offering free tastings of Palouzes, pastries with grape syrup, Zivania and Halloumi. There will be also a live show of Cypriot Music, traditional dances and songs (between 13:30 – 17:00).

 

When: 28/05/2023

Time: 10:00 – 18:00

Venues: Village Square, Shepherd’s Museum and Primary School.
